Crewmembers of the guided missile submarine USS Georgia (SSGN 729) stand at parade rest during a return to service ceremony for the boat in Kings Bay, Ga., on March 28, 2008. The submarine is being returned to service after being converted to conventional land attack and Special Operations Forces platform.
